You will receive a compelling story of the origins of Richmond from small tobacco town to Capitol of the Commonwealth on a leisurely 100 minute stroll. Learn about Richmond's role in the Civil War, as well as its major prominence in the Civil Rights movement. Each guest will leave with a comprehensive understanding of the city and what to see and do next in RVA.
